Output dd54accb5dfc8308e8af8e3ea33faca729510821dad01f18d4555141937434fa:0

value
69410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07a0e2d1e1066aea8de4643f0d94c2cb772e77e OP_EQUAL
address
3LhLgzzXRsLoHozMC6BMg2wQCCm7yBhsaa
transaction
dd54accb5dfc8308e8af8e3ea33faca729510821dad01f18d4555141937434fa
confirmations
201957
spent
true